福建鸳鸯猕猴自然保护区有维管束植物152科434属745种,分别占福建省科、属、种数的65.80%、34.53%、19.97%。该区系的表征科是蔷薇科、壳斗科、樟科、冬青科、茶科、木兰科、山矾科。属的地理成分主要是泛热带分布型(24.42%)、热带亚洲分布型(10.83%)、北温带分布型(14.52%)和东亚分布型(11.52%)。属的地理成分组成为:热带分布型的共226属,占总属数的57.51%;温带分布型的共167属,占总属数的42.49%。本区系与福建永春牛姆林区系十分相近,与福建南平矇瞳洋区系的联系密切,本区系属华南区系的一部分。 相似文献

云南4种材用丛生竹的组织结构 总被引:4,自引:1,他引:4
以维管束密度和纤维比量的检测分析结果为依据,认定云南4种材用丛生竹(龙竹,甜龙竹,黄竹和油勒竹)的结构具较大差异;同一竹种沿竹秆径向和纵向的结构是不均匀的,且径向上的不均匀性远较纵向上的不均匀性为高,但竹材梢部的结构均匀性较其基部的为好。 相似文献

丰林自然保护区种子植物区系研究 总被引:2,自引:1,他引:2
丰林自然保护区有维管束植物89科299属597种(含种下单位),其中:种子植物76科275属560种,分别占黑龙江省种子植物科、属、种数的73.79%、45.30%和34.15%,占小兴安岭种子植物科、属、种数的77.55%、67.07%和55.94%;本区有珍稀濒危植物8种,分别占黑龙江省和小兴安岭珍稀濒危植物种数的57.14%和80.00%,是黑龙江省和小兴安岭珍稀濒危植物集中分布区之一,为小兴安岭植物区系的典型代表区域。在种子植物中,仅分布有1属的科有41科,其中只有1种的科为24科,仅含1种的属多达164属。科的分布区类型有6个,主要为世界广布(48.68%)、北温带分布(25.00%)和泛热带分布(21.05%);属的分布区类型有11个,温带性质的属占优势,有209属,占76.00%;种的分布区类型有16个,除世界分布和中国特有种外,温带性质的种415种,占该区总种数的74.11%,亚寒带 寒带性质的种92种,占该区总种数的16.43%,热带性质的种34种,占该区总种数的6.07%。区系基本特征为:植物种类相对丰富,地理成分较复杂,具有“科多、属多、种少”的特点,反映出区系的相对古老性和保守性;有较多的寡种属和单种属,反映出植物物种多样性的丰富性和复杂性;以北温带植物区系成分为主,并混有亚热带、热带及亚寒带、寒带植物区系成分,形成南、北混合型。本文对丰林自然保护区种子植物区系的分析,可为该区种子植物的保护和利用及保护区的科学管理提供科学依据。 相似文献

Shih-Wei Lin Shih-Chung Huang Hsiao-Mei Kuo Chiu-Hua Chen Yi-Ling Ma Tian-Huei Chu Youn-Shen Bee E-Ming Wang Chang-Yi Wu Ping-Jyun Sung Zhi-Hong Wen Deng-Chyang Wu Jyh-Horng Sheu Ming-Hong Tai 《Marine drugs》2015,13(2):861-878
Background: WA-25 (dihydroaustrasulfone alcohol, a synthetic derivative of marine compound WE-2) suppresses atherosclerosis in rats by reducing neointima formation. Because angiogenesis plays a critical role in the pathogenesis of atherosclerosis, the present study investigated the angiogenic function and mechanism of WA-25. Methods: The angiogenic effect of WA-25 was evaluated using a rat aortic ring assay and transgenic zebrafish models were established using transgenic Tg(fli-1:EGFP)y1 and Tg(kdrl:mCherryci5-fli1a:negfpy7) zebrafish embryos. In addition, the effect of WA-25 on distinct angiogenic processes, including matrix metalloproteinase (MMP) expression, endothelial cell proliferation and migration, as well as tube formation, was studied using human umbilical vein endothelial cells (HUVECs). The effect of WA-25 on the endothelial vascular endothelial growth factor (VEGF) signaling pathway was elucidated using qRT-PCR, immunoblot analysis, immunofluorescence and flow cytometric analyses. Results: The application of WA-25 perturbed the development of intersegmental vessels in transgenic zebrafish. Moreover, WA-25 potently suppressed microvessel sprouting in organotypic rat aortic rings. Among cultured endothelial cells, WA-25 significantly and dose-dependently inhibited MMP-2/MMP-9 expression, proliferation, migration and tube formation in HUVECs. Mechanistic studies revealed that WA-25 significantly reduced the VEGF release by reducing VEGF expression at the mRNA and protein levels. In addition, WA-25 reduced surface VEGF receptor 2 (VEGFR2/Flk-1) expression by repressing the VEGFR2 mRNA level. Finally, an exogenous VEGF supply partially rescued the WA-25-induced angiogenesis blockage in vitro and in vivo. Conclusions: WA-25 is a potent angiogenesis inhibitor that acts through the down-regulation of VEGF and VEGFR2 in endothelial cells. General
Significance: WA-25 may constitute a novel anti-angiogenic drug that acts by targeting endothelial VEGF/VEGFR2 signaling. 相似文献

Summary An extracellular protein-lipopolysaccaride antigen (PLP) was purified from culture fluids ofVerticillium dahliae. Antiserum produced in rabbits to the PLP detected the antigen in homogenates of tubers, stems and leaves ofV. dahliae-infected potato plants but not in extracts of healthy potato tissue or extracts of potato plants infected by other fungal
pathogens. The antigen was not detectable in extracts of potato isolates ofV. tricorpus, V. nigrescens andV. nubilum or various other fungi. The antigen was shown to be different from cross-reactive antigens detected by antisera to mycelial
antigens. When used as a tool for specific diagnosis ofV. dahliae infection in potato, antiserum to PLP was more reliable than that prepared against fungal body antigens.

经过对西沙永乐群岛8个岛礁的植物资源进行调查,共记录高等植物158种,涉及53科132属,野生植物90种,栽培植物68种。各岛礁植物种类差异较大,晋卿岛124种、甘泉岛56种、石屿1种、羚羊礁24种、广金岛29种、鸭公岛12种、银屿39种、全富岛0种,在调查范围内较为常见的植物有34种,其中24种为野生植物,10种为栽培植物,野生植物明显多于栽培植物,占70.59%。本次调查摸清了这8个岛礁的植物本底和分布特征,为岛礁植物保育、引种、开发利用打下良好基础。 相似文献

Darren K. Okimoto Joseph J. DiStefano III Todd T. Kuwaye Benny Ron Gregory M. Weber Thuvan T. Nguyen E. Gordon Grau 《Fish physiology and biochemistry》1994,12(5):431-438
Plasma volumes in male tilapia (Oreochromis mossambicus) of different size were estimated following intracardial injection of radioiodinated human serum albumin (125I-HSA), coupled with short-term, early sampling transient response analysis of 1251-HSA disappearance from the plasma pool.
This approach circumvents vascular marker leakage problems associated with constant steady state indicator dilution methods,
minimizes some sampling and mixing problems, and simplifies analysis of the data. Changes in hematological parameters due
to experimental stress were also studied, because the fish were not chronically cannulated. Results were used in a novel way
to correct estimates of plasma volume upward by 15%, thereby providing a potentially useful alternative approach to vascular
volume measurement in species where stress-eliminating or reducing techniques, e.g., cannulation, are impractical or infeasible. Hematrocrits increased 38% at the onset, from 24.9% to 34.4%, and remained essentially
constant during the 60 minute kinetic study, and plasma osmolalities increased 7%. Corrected plasma volumes Vp (ml) were a linear function of body weight (BW). The group mean Vp was 2.93% of BW and corresponding blood volumes were 3.9% of BW. 相似文献
